Average Car Insurance in Ontario by Rating Factor

The car insurance rates for two people under the same ZIP code will mostly be different. This is mostly because insurance rates are calculated based on several rating factors. These rating factors include the driver's age, gender, marital status, driving and claims history, credit score, location, type of vehicle, and coverage levels.

I have a clean driving record. Why is my car insurance rate here in Ontario, WI increasing?

Despite maintaining a clean driving record, your car insurance rates in Ontario, Wisconsin, may be increasing due to several external factors. Wisconsin has experienced significant rate hikes recently, with average premiums rising by 25.5% in 2023, largely attributed to higher claims volumes and inflation.

Additionally, Ontario's high urban population density, raised auto theft rates, and frequent natural disasters contribute to increased insurance costs.

Car Insurance Rates by Credit Score & Driving History

Similar to your driving history, your financial history also plays a key role in determining your auto insurance rates. A low credit score would mean a lapse in payment and increased chances of filing claims, which results in higher auto insurance rates. Therefore, the higher the credit score, the lower the car insurance rates will be.

Way Tip

Avoid Having A DUI On Your Driving Record.

A DUI can increase your car insurance rates—by $5,000 to $10,000 over five years. Speeding, reckless driving, and at-fault accidents also raise rates, staying on your record for 3–5 years, while DUIs/DWIs can impact you longer.
